At least one group of 4 people thought today was a great day for some ice fishing. However, a week of temps at or near 60 degrees does funny things to ice as this group found out on a Rochester lake/reclaimed sand pit. Judging by what the news coverage showed, they went thru as they approached the edge of the ice sheet near a beach area with deep water. The beach has a spring that helps keep the ice thin unless we get some real serious cold and the ice appeared honeycombed where they took the dip. All 4 got yanked out by other anglers using a long tree limb. One was an adult....sorta. The others were just kids.
